The Australian women’s team, a 9-2 victor over Kazakhstan Saturday in the first-ever Olympic women’s water polo match, followed up with a 6-3 victory over Russia today at Ryde.
Bridgette Gusterson scored two second-half goals, including the one that put Australia ahead to stay, at 4-3, with 52 seconds left in the third quarter.
In its first match, Russia had to settle for a 7-7 tie with Canada.
